(a) TRS program applicants must complete:
(1) an orientation on the TRS guidelines, including an overview of the:
- (A) TRS program application process;
- (B) TRS program measures; and
- (C) TRS program assessment process; and
- (2) a TRS program self-assessment tool.
(b) Boards shall ensure that:
- (1) written acknowledgment of receipt of the application and self-assessment is sent to the provider;
- (2) within 20 days of receipt of the application, the provider is sent an estimated time frame for scheduling the initial assessment;
- (3) an assessment is conducted for any provider that meets the eligibility requirements in §809.131 and requests to participate in the TRS program; and
- (4) TRS certification is granted for any provider that is assessed and verified as meeting the TRS provider certification criteria set forth in the TRS guidelines.
(c) Boards shall ensure that TRS assessments are conducted as follows:
- (1) On-site assessment of 100 percent of the provider classrooms at the initial assessment for TRS certification and at each scheduled recertification; and
- (2) Recertification of all TRS providers every three years.
(d) Boards shall ensure that certified TRS providers are monitored on an annual basis and the monitoring includes:
- (1) at least one unannounced on-site visit; and
- (2) a review of the provider's licensing compliance as described in new §809.132.
- (e) Boards shall ensure compliance with the process and procedures in the TRS guidelines for conducting assessments of nationally accredited child care facilities and child care facilities regulated by the US Military.
- (f) Boards shall ensure compliance with the process and procedures in the TRS guidelines for conducting assessments of certified TRS providers that have a change of ownership, move, or expand locations.
